Man Punched Over Mall Parking Spot: Blotter

Orland Park police reports, Feb. 16-18.

MONDAY, FEB. 18

Outstanding Warrant

Daniel S. Wolf, 26, of the 13600 block of South 88th Avenue in Orland Park, was arrested at about 1:10 p.m. on an outstanding warrant for driving with a suspended license from Orland Park police, according to a report.

Police had checked Wolf’s status after they were called to 15014 S. LaGrange Rd., on a report of someone walking around the plaza, according to a report. The warranted had been issued on Jan. 25, 2013. He was given a new court date of March 8 in the Bridgeview Courthouse.

Macy's Theft

British E. Hammons, 18, of the 9600 block of Hoxie Street in Chicago, was charged with retail theft, according to a report. Loss prevention officers at Macy’s Department Store, 1 Orland Square Dr., had stopped Hammons at about 7:30 p.m. after allegedly watching her take several pieces of clothing off the displays.

She and another woman reportedly were seen taking the clothing with them into the changing room, according to a report. A Macy’s employee stopped Hammons but the other person ran off. She is accused of taking $298 worth of clothing in her purse and was due in Bridgeview court on March 6.

SATURDAY, FEB. 16

Fight Over Parking Space

Ryan L. Holmes, 20, of the 4600 block of South La Crosse Avenue in Chicago, was charged with battery, according to a report. The alleged victim told police that he was about to pull his 2013 Hyandai into a parking space at the Orland Square Mall, 288 Orland Square Rd., when a purple PT Cruiser stole it. He drove by the car, rolled down his window and said “Really?”

An argument between the two men followed, with both leaving their cars. The fight allegedly became physical when Holmes punched the other man in the face twice. He refused medical treatment. The victim’s wife had captured the fight on her cell phone’s video camera. Police watching the video confirmed the victim’s story.

Holmes reportedly admitted to punching the other man and that he did not fight back, according to a report. He was booked for battery and given a court date of March 8 in Bridgeview.
